Hidden Valley Campground is located between the Powderhorn and La Garita Wilderness Areas and is great for folks interested in hiking and backpacking. This small campground is designed for tent camping only. Most campsites are walk-in sites, accessed by footbridge over Cebolla Creek. The campground lies in a narrow canyon with spruce, fir and aspen trees along the creek.

Yes. Hidden Valley Campground is free to use. It is managed by the USFS.
From Lake City, CO, drive south on State Highway 149 to Forest Road 788. Turn left on Forest Road 788 and drive six miles to the campground, past Deer Lakes Campground.
This is bear country: campers must properly store food and other attractants.
